Transaction 2d8e577433ee3be524d8eaf6442d8420715960bc1e514d3a953b622f8fe2e05f

1 Input
2 Outputs
  • 2d8e577433ee3be524d8eaf6442d8420715960bc1e514d3a953b622f8fe2e05f:0
  • value  5980695766
    address  1FsTHTNXEpHFuBWATTSSuDPYkjK2ERn83e
  • 2d8e577433ee3be524d8eaf6442d8420715960bc1e514d3a953b622f8fe2e05f:1
  • value  5000000
    address  1Ghzu131Vz3DyJYbeLxTAUBVWRy48CPoUY